Covid-19 situation in Mumbai is not improving even an inch even though approx 50,000 people of the city are vaccinated so far. The number of active patients in the city is rising day by day making it a concerning issue for the Maharashtra government following which last month a temporary lockdown was put. The government has decided to expand the lockdown to 11 more locations till 31st March.

Now, the city is under the surveillance of BMC to curb the spread and government has issued lockdown guidelines for the same. As of February 14, Borivali, KW Ward, Andheri East, Mulund, Chembur, Ghatkopar, vile Parle West, and many more areas have become the covid hotspots in Mumbai.

The highest cases and deaths due to covid have been recorded in Borivali as per the records stated by Government. The second major hotspot is Vile Parle West with 378 cases.

Officials have also sealed buildings to reduce the spread of the virus. Even though the figures are concerning for the government, the recovery rate of the city is 94 %. Till now, 992 buildings are completely sealed and 85 zones have been announced as active containment zones.
